Rare, white lions find new home in Venezuelan Zoo

Sharjah24 – Reuters: Three young white lions found a new home in the Caricuao Zoo in Venezuela's capital Caracas, where authorities hope they will encourage more visitors to the vast open-air facility.
The three lions, one female and two males are about two years old and weigh about 120 kilos (264 lbs). The lions arrived last week in Venezuela and remain in quarantine in large cages at the 636-hectare Caricuao Zoo in southwestern Caracas, Bernardo Pereira, manager of the Zoo's animal nutrition department told Reuters.

Pereira added that the lions, originally from South Africa, arrived from a zoo in the Czech Republic and are part of a joint effort by authorities to improve zoos and parks across the South American country.

The three lions will remain in quarantine until the end of June and then will be reinstated into bigger enclosures where tourists can see them.

With the three as-yet-unnamed lions, the Caricuao Zoo is now home to some 335 animals, from 36 different species including primates, felines, and reptiles.
